Cast member Charlize Theron attends the “Atomic Blonde” World Premiere at Stage Theater on July 17, 2017 in Berlin, Germany. (Photo by Alamy Stock Photo)
Wang Xianxiang carries two buckets of water with his eyelids during a provincial festival for migrant workers in Shaodong County, Hunan province, Saturday.
“The ‘mirror man’ aka ‘The Collector‘ is by the artist Gustav Troger of San Francisco & Vienna. He is in North America now on another ‘The Collector’ tour.”